Description
The ECOLAB Process Indicator is an essential tool for ensuring the effectiveness of sterilisation processes in various healthcare settings. Designed for use primarily in environments such as dental clinics and central sterile departments, this indicator provides reliable monitoring of sterilisation conditions, particularly for steam sterilisation.
Key Features
- Versatile Compatibility: Suitable for a range of sterilisation methods including steam, ethylene oxide, hydrogen peroxide, formaldehyde, dry heat, and gamma radiation.
- Highly Sensitive Ink: Changes color to signal exposure to the appropriate sterilisation process, with distinct color transitions such as purple to green for hydrogen peroxide and dark blue to brown for dry heat.
- Multiple Forms: Available as indicator tapes, double self-adhesive labels, Bowie-Dick test sheets, and emulator indicators, catering to diverse sterilisation needs.
Practical Applications
- Packaging Versatility: Effective on various packaging materials like cloth, paper, and plastic, ensuring clear indication of sterilisation status.
- Easy Application: Indicator tapes are self-adhesive, single-use, and leave no residue, making them convenient for external use.
- Printable Options: Some indicators are printable, allowing for seamless integration into package labelling.
Regulatory Compliance
Registered as a Class 1 medical device, the ECOLAB Process Indicator is listed under ARTG ID 484908, with registration effective from 1 April 2025. Sponsored and manufactured by Ecolab Pty Ltd, it adheres to stringent regulatory standards, providing peace of mind to healthcare professionals.
